Types of Corporate Events
From team-building retreats to product launches, corporate events come in various forms, each tailored to achieve specific objectives. Whether it's an annual conference, a gala dinner, or a networking event, the key is to create an experience that resonates with attendees and aligns with the organization's goals. A growing trend is that corporate events are more of collaboration between the attendees and organization. There is a two way flow of information allowing you to gain deep insight into the inner thinking of your audience. No one wants to attend a lecture. Hanging out with your favorite brand and sharing ideas though a vibrant discussion is a a far more attractive position.
